Romanian Weekends at The Wharf – 4th Edition

July 11-13, 2025

This summer, Washington, D.C. welcomed the fourth edition of Romanian Weekends at The Wharf, a joyful celebration of Romania’s living heritage along the waterfront. HORA was proud to be part of this dynamic cultural event, which brought together communities, artists, and traditions in a spirited display of Romanian identity.

🎶 Live Music & Dance Visitors were treated to exhilarating performances that showcased Romania’s diverse musical and dance traditions—from high-energy folk dances to hauntingly beautiful melodies echoing through the open air.

🎨 Traditional Craft Demonstrations Artisans displayed the artistry of Romanian folk crafts, sharing age-old techniques behind icon glass painting, weaving, leader shoe (opinci) making. Guests witnessed creativity in action, connecting with the country’s rich history of handmade design.

🍷 Authentic Cuisine & Wine Tastings The tastes of Romania came alive with sizzling meats, savory vegetarian dishes, and delicious desserts. Pairing perfectly with these bites were curated selections of Romanian wine—each glass telling its own story of terroir and tradition.

🏛️ Heritage Exhibitions Interactive displays and exhibits invited attendees to delve deeper into Romania’s historical legacy, rural customs, and national pride.

From casual passersby to dedicated culture lovers, this immersive weekend sparked curiosity, friendship, and an even greater appreciation for the vibrant spirit of Romanian traditions.
